Richard Griffiths was a man of Falstaff-ian girth, particularly when looking at the "Henry Crabbe" years - a time when the waistline was an equator...

He later went on to star as Hector in History Boys, on stage and screen, as well as the ten-ish years of Harry Potter as Uncle Vernon Dursley... if you notice in the last appearance in the series (...The Deathly Hallows, Part 1), like his co-star Harry Mellor (Dudley Dursley), Griffiths is clearly in a fat-suit (adding the appearance of about another 25lbs), Mellor's added closer to 100lbs.

In the words of Eric Cartman... not Fat, just big boned, festively plump, etc.

Sadly Griffiths passed due to complications of Heart Surgery.
